Assayer Institute of Innovative Education has below criteria for taking admissions to it's various courses:
CoursesEligibility
MBA/PGDMCandidate must be a graduate from a recognized University.
B.A.Candidate must have passed 10+2 or equivalent examination from a recognized school/board.
B.ComCandidate must have passed 10+2 or equivalent examination from a recognized school/board.
B.Sc.Candidate must have passed 10+2 or equivalent examination from a recognized school/board.
BBACandidate must have passed 10+2 or equivalent examination from a recognized school/board.
BCACandidate must have passed 10+2 or equivalent examination from a recognized school/board.
BHMCandidate must have passed 10+2 or equivalent examination from a recognized school/board.
B.E. / B.TechLateral Entry Eligibility Candidates must have passed Diploma or B.Sc with Mathematics scoring minimum 50% marks in aggregate. Lateral Entry Exam UPSEE
